## CI note: ReplicaWatch lag alarm flapping

Plugin authors: if your integration tests trip the Duskhaven read-replica lag alarm, it's almost always because the seeding step writes faster than the replica applies. Throttle fixture inserts to batches of 500, or add the documented settle step before assertions. Do not silence the alarm in plugin pipelines; it masks genuine replication stalls. If the alarm persists after throttling, attach logs and cite the runner build noted below.

pipeline stamp: htk31_f769b577b3028a4e9958e5bb8d1259a

**Ticket: Expired credential blocking telemetry compression rollout**

The Quillhaven compressor service, which applies zstd to outbound telemetry payloads before they reach the Marrowgate ingest queue, began rejecting requests at 04:32 with authentication errors. Investigation confirmed the service credential expired and was never enrolled in automatic rotation. Compression is currently bypassed, inflating bandwidth roughly fourfold. A replacement credential has been provisioned and validated; it appears below.

service key, hawef-kawef: qvz4-ml4y

## Hardware Lab Access

Team assistants booking kit for the Quillbrook lab: the lab on Level 3 isn't on standard badges, so don't promise same-day access. Request lab rights through the Dunmore portal at least a day ahead. If you're just dropping off equipment, use the side door by the loading bay — it opens with the code below.

staff pass of kawip-hawef = bdg-QLP-2

TICKET: Turnstile counter drift — Falconmere Arena

The GateTally counter service in the east concourse is running stale config. Someone hand-edited the node to bump the debounce window during the playoff rush and never committed it. Counts now disagree with the provisioned baseline by roughly 3%. Do not patch live again; redeploy from the repo. The values currently active on the drifted node are below.

deployment values, fahap-hahaf:
[casdor]
port = 9200
region = south-2
host = casdor.qirvanworks.corp
timeout_ms = 3000
retries = 4